AI Technical Summary

Technical Problem

Existing open-type deep-throat fixed-table presses require manual adjustment of the horizontal and longitudinal positions of the sheet metal during the sheet metal stamping process to achieve all-around stamping, resulting in low efficiency.

Method used

The system employs a limit adjustment structure, including components such as a moving plate, a limit cover, an electric push rod, and a ball screw, to achieve automatic limit adjustment of the sheet metal in the horizontal and vertical directions, and to automatically adjust the position of the sheet metal to achieve omnidirectional stamping.

Benefits of technology

No manual adjustment of the sheet material position is required, enabling omnidirectional stamping of the sheet material, which improves stamping efficiency and automation, and saves raw materials.

TECHNICAL FIELD

[0001] The utility model belongs to open deep throat fixed platform press technical field especially relates to a kind of open deep throat fixed platform press with limit adjustment structure. BACKGROUND

[0002] Open deep throat mouth press is the open fixed platform press of throat mouth depth increase, throat mouth depth is usually more than twice of general C-type press, widely applicable to the automatic operation of plate punching, also applicable to the punching workpiece of large area sheet metal, sheet metal can be once punched forming without turning, can avoid the problem that ordinary C-type press is restricted by throat mouth depth in front and back direction of work surface and cannot be once punched forming, widen processing range, can improve punching efficiency, save raw materials.

[0003] The existing open deep throat fixed platform press is mostly limited when plate is punched, and the plate can only be manually pushed horizontally, as the punching area may be a small part of the plate width, so that the plate needs to be adjusted horizontally after being once horizontally punched, so as to be punched in all directions.

[0004] Therefore, an open deep throat fixed platform press with limit adjustment structure is proposed. INVENTION CONTENTS

[0021] The utility model discloses an open deep throat fixed platform press with limiting adjustment structure, as shown in Figures 1-4 The utility model discloses an open deep throat fixed platform press with limiting adjustment structure, as shown in formula 1, including open deep throat fixed platform press body 1, the upper setting of open deep throat fixed platform press body 1 has the stamping station 2, and the outer lateral wall of open deep throat fixed platform press body 1 is close to the one side position of stamping station 2 and is connected with fixed seat 3 through bolt fixedly, fixed seat 3 is provided with two, and two fixed seat 3 symmetrical setting is on the outer lateral wall of open deep throat fixed platform press body 1, the outer lateral wall of fixed seat 3 is close to the one side of stamping station 2 and is connected with motor 4 through bolt fixedly, the output end fixed connection of motor 4 has ball screw 5 through its one side, the recess cavity that can be rotated for ball screw 5 is set up on the outer lateral wall of fixed seat 3, the nut seat on ball screw 5 is fixedly connected with moving platform 6 through screw, the outer lateral wall of moving platform 6 is away from fixed seat 3 and is connected with first electric push rod 7 through bolt fixedly on one side, the output end fixed connection of first electric push rod 7 has moving plate 8 through its one side, the top of fixed seat 3, moving plate 8 and stamping station 2 is on the same horizontal plane, the outer lateral wall of moving platform 6 is close to the one side position of first electric push rod 7 and is welded with guide column 9, the outer lateral wall of moving plate 8 is close to the one side position of guide column 9 and is set up with guide hole 10, guide column 9 passes through guide hole 10, the top of moving plate 8 is fixedly connected with limit cover 11 through screw, the outer lateral wall of limit cover 11 is set up with through slot 12, and the outer lateral wall of limit cover 11 is close to the one side position of through slot 12 and is connected with support cover 13 through bolt fixedly, the outer lateral wall of support cover 13 is away from limit cover 11 and is connected with second electric push rod 14 through bolt fixedly on one side, the output end fixed connection of second electric push rod 14 has limit plugboard 15 through its one side.

[0022] It should be noted that, since the punching area can be a small part of the width of the plate, so that the plate needs to be adjusted in the horizontal longitudinal position after completing a horizontal transverse punching, so as to punch the plate in all directions, the embodiment can adjust the position of the plate which has been limited in the horizontal and vertical directions by moving the moving plate 8 in the horizontal longitudinal direction and the limiting cover 11 in the horizontal transverse direction, so as to realize the punching of the other part of the plate after the punching of a part of the plate is completed, the position of the plate on the punching table 2 can be adjusted, and then the all-direction punching of the plate is realized without manual position adjustment, and the position adjustment of the plate in the limiting state is ensured.

[0023] Specifically, in the embodiment, the scheme mainly includes the fixed seat 3, the moving table 6, the moving plate 8 and the limiting cover 11, in use, the distance between the two limiting covers 11 is adjusted according to the length of the plate (not shown in the figure, the width of the plate is the same as the inner width of the limiting cover 11, and the top of the plate and the inner bottom of the through slot 12 are at the same horizontal plane, in other words, the limiting adjustment structure is customized for the plate), the moving plate 8 is driven to move by the first electric push rod 7 through the output end on one side of the first electric push rod 7, the limiting cover 11 on the top of the moving plate 8 is synchronously moved through the guide hole 10 and the guide column 9, when the distance between the two limiting covers 11 is adjusted to the required length, the plate is inserted into the two limiting covers 11, the plate is located above the punching table 2, and the two ends of the plate are located in the two limiting covers 11 respectively, so as to limit the plate in the horizontal direction, after the plate is placed, the limiting insert plate 15 is driven to move horizontally by the second electric push rod 14 through the output end on one side of the second electric push rod 14, the limiting insert plate 15 is inserted above the plate after penetrating through the through slot 12, so as to limit the plate in the vertical direction, when the punching operation is performed, the plate on the punching table 2 is punched by the open deep-throat fixed table press body 1, when the plate is transversely punched, the two limiting covers 11 are moved in the same direction by controlling the two first electric push rods 7 respectively, so as to make the plate on the punching table 2 move linearly in the horizontal direction, the plate is transversely punched by the open deep-throat fixed table press body 1, after the transverse punching of the plate in a part of the position is completed, the ball screw 5 is driven to rotate by the motor 4 through the output end on one side of the motor 4, the moving table 6 on the ball screw 5 slides on the fixed seat 3, so as to make the plate move longitudinally in the horizontal direction, and finally the transverse movement of the plate is utilized to realize the punching of the remaining positions on the plate.

[0024] As shown in the further preferred embodiment of the utility model, Figures 2-3 The moving table 6 and the fixed seat 3 are connected through the sliding block and the sliding groove with the cross section T, and the sliding groove penetrates through the two side walls of the fixed seat 3.

[0025] In the embodiment, the T-shaped slider and the sliding slot can ensure the stability of the moving table 6 moving on the fixed base 3, avoid the moving table 6 from falling off the fixed base 3, provide space for the moving table 6 through the sliding slot, and facilitate the longitudinal position adjustment of the plate.

[0026] In the further preferred embodiment of the utility model, as shown in the drawings, Figure 4 The limiting plugboard 15 is located at the inner side of the through slot 12, and the limiting plugboard 15 and the through slot 12 are matched and fitted.

[0027] In the embodiment, the limiting plugboard 15 is inserted into the upper side of the plate through the through slot 12, limiting the plate in the vertical direction, and avoiding the plate from shaking in the vertical direction.
